Two Army porters killed, three injured in Pak shelling in Poonch sector

Srinagar, Jan 10 : Two persons working as Army porters were killed while three others sustained injured injuries after Pakistan restored to mortar shelling in Poonch sector on Friday.

According to the wire service— officials said that Pakistan resorted to mortar shelling at around 11:30 AM today in Kasaliya area of Poonch sector near Khari Karmara  along Line of Control.

The incident resulted into the death of two Army porters, who have been identified as Muhammad Aslam and Altaf Hussain, officials said.

They added that three other Army porters identified as Muhammad Saleem, Showkat Hussain and Muhammad Nawaz were injured during the incident. The officials said that the incident took place when the Army porters were busy in their day-to-day work.

Meanwhile, an explosion in Jangar area of Nowshehra sector in Rajouri district has caused injuries to an Army man. The injured Army man whose name couldn’t be ascertained was hospitalized where he is receiving treatment. (KNO)
